How to Start Learning Prompting

  • Be clear and specific. Tell the AI what you want, how you want it, and who it’s for.

  • Give context. AI isn’t a mind reader—it thrives on background.

  • Iterate. Prompting is a conversation. Don’t settle for the first answer—refine it.

  • Study great prompts. Steal like an artist. Find examples, tweak them, make them yours.
